Heading into the 1989 WSOP main event, Johnny Chan was on top of the poker world. Television commentator Chris Marlowe was part of the broadcast for each of Chan's two. It's May 19th 1989 and the World Series of Poker Main Event is on the brink of being decided. Just two competitors remain from a starting field of 178. On one side of the table is a young and relatively unknown player by the name of Phil Hellmuth. He is just 24 years old and has never won a world series bracelet before.

In the latest Best Poker Moments video, Phil Hellmuth looks back at his historic victory over Johnny Chan at the 1989 World Series of Poker Main Event. Chan had won the world championship the previous two years in a row. He was the favorite. Hellmuth was a 24-year-old already making a name for himself on the pro poker circuit. The brash and bold Phil Hellmuth, of Madison, Wisconsin, had other plans however, as the 24-year old toppled Chan to be crowned the 1989 WSOP Main Event winner and collected his first of many WSOP bracelets and the $755,000 first-place prize. The 20th Annual World Series of Poker (WSOP) was held at Binion's Horseshoe in Downtown Las Vegas.

When Phil Hellmuth won his first main event title in 1989 at the age of 24, he became the youngest player to ever do it. Hellmuth went up against defending back-to-back champion Johnny Chan at the final table. Chan moved all-in with Ace-7 of spades and Hellmuth called with pocket 9's.
